Summary of the Driving License in Poland
In Poland, driving licenses are managed by the Ministry of Infrastructure and are classified into different classes based on the type of lorry being driven. The most common licenses are:

The process of acquiring a driving license in Poland can be divided into a number of essential steps:

Eligibility Requirements
Minimum age: 18 years for classification B (cars) and A (bikes).Needed files: Valid identification (passport or national ID) and evidence of residency.
Medical exam
Candidates need to go through a medical exam carried out by a certified doctor to ensure they meet the health standards required for drivers.
Selecting a Driving School
Select a licensed driving school (Szkoła Kup Nowe Prawo Jazdy W Polsce) that provides the necessary training for your preferred license classification.
Theoretical Training
Complete the theoretical training which typically lasts several weeks. This training covers traffic laws, roadway indications, and safe driving practices.
Theoretical Exam
After completing the theoretical training, applicants must pass a theoretical test that consists of multiple-choice questions. A score of at least 68% is required to continue.
Practical Training
When the theoretical exam is passed, candidates will undergo useful driving lessons, usually spanning a number of hours of behind-the-wheel instruction.
Practical Exam
The last step is to pass the practical driving test that assesses the applicant's ability to operate an automobile securely and effectively.
Getting the License

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What files do I require to bring when requesting a driving license in Poland?
You will need:
A valid ID (passport or national ID card).Proof of residency.A completed medical evaluation certificate.Evidence of payment for the evaluation and application charges.2. The length of time does it take to get a driving license in Poland?
The timeline can vary considerably. Normally, the procedure takes in between three months to a year, depending on the schedule of driving tests, the efficiency of the driving school, and the candidate's schedule.
3. Can an immigrant get a driving license in Poland?
Yes, immigrants can obtain a Polish driving license if they fulfill the eligibility requirements. They might also be permitted to use their foreign driving license for a particular duration, depending upon their nation of origin.
4. Is it possible to transform a foreign driving license to a Polish one?
Yes, foreigners can use to convert their foreign driving license, based on specific conditions. The procedure involves examining the validity of the foreign license and conference any extra regional requirements.
5. What takes place if I stop working the driving test?
If a candidate stops working the driving test, they can reapply for another effort after a waiting period. The variety of times a person can retake the exam is generally not limited, however there might be charges connected to each retake.
